【#52 ネットワーク CCNA CCNP 講座】ロードバランサってなんだ?(前編)

サーバー 負荷 分散

基本的な負荷分散設定では、クライアントはNetScalerアプライアンスで構成された仮想サーバーのIPアドレスに要求を送信します。仮想サーバーは、負荷分散アルゴリズムと呼ばれる事前設定されたパターンに従って、負荷分散アプリケーションサーバーに分散します。 ボトルネックの考え方は大きく2つ. 1. CPU負荷 2. I/O負荷. 1. CPU負荷ってなんぞ?. あるプロセス (プログラム)がCPUを使い使用率100%の状態が長く続いてしまった場合、他のプロセスの実行を妨害してしまいます。. 一つ語弊があると困りますが、CPU使用率100 負荷分散とは、演算処理にかかる負荷を2台以上のコンピュータ間で分散させる方法です。 インターネットでは、ネットワークトラフィックを複数のサーバーに振り分けるために、多くの場合負荷分散が採用されます。 これにより、各サーバーにかかる負担が軽減され、サーバーの効率が上がり、 パフォーマンス の高速化と レイテンシー の低減が可能になります。 負荷分散は、ほとんどのインターネットアプリケーションが正常に機能するために必要不可欠です。 あるスーパーにレジの列が8つあり、そのうち1つだけしか開いていない状態を想像してください。 すべての客が同じ列に並ばなければならないため、客が買い物の支払いを終えるまでには長い時間がかかります。 今度は、その店が8つのレジすべてを開けたとします。 大規模なサーバーを運用する上で欠かせないのが負荷分散(ロードバランシング)の技術です。 1台のサーバーに大量にアクセスが集中すると、どんなにスペックが高いマシンでも負荷によってパフォーマンスが低下し、表示の遅延やエラーが頻発するようになります。 そこで、複数台のサーバーにアクセスを振り分ける役割を担うのが、負荷分散のテクノロジーです。 今回の記事では、ウェブサイトの負荷分散を行なう、DNSラウンドロビンとロードバランサーについて解説します。 記事の目次 [] 大規模サービスに欠かせない負荷分散の技術 DNSラウンドロビンによる負荷分散 ロードバランサーによる負荷分散 まとめ 大規模サービスに欠かせない負荷分散の技術 |kov| qqj| atl| dvn| qkv| jmk| ury| zhj| hec| pbi| whp| ydh| qta| uvj| kjf| acl| bsx| pti| gth| fja| djs| orc| tue| ems| aez| wlr| zcg| cvp| zaq| gzo| blv| wxa| ida| zsc| xuc| xpe| ani| ato| vex| ufk| qqt| qoe| ppj| hnb| wwa| eqj| zuc| qjk| xbt| bpw|